The Ohio Environmental Protection Agency has issued a statewide Air Quality Advisory for the entire state of Ohio as smoke from Canadian wildfires continues to adversely impact air quality.
Pollutants across the state are expected to range from the 'Unhealthy For Sensitive Groups' category in the southwest part of the state to the 'Unhealthy' category in the rest of the state. Hourly concentrations at times may reach the 'Very Unhealthy' to 'Hazardous' categories.
It is recommended, when possible, to avoid strenuous outdoor activities, especially those with heart disease and respiratory conditions like asthma. Watch for symptoms including wheezing, coughing, chest tightness, dizziness, or burning in the nose, throat, and eyes.

Trinity Fuson
Trinity E. Fuson, 2, of Celina, Ohio, passed away on Thursday, April 28, 2016 in Port Orange, FL, due to the result of a tragic accident.
She was born February 17, 2014 in Lima, Ohio to Derrin A. Fuson and Brooke Roberts, both survive in Celina.
Other survivors include two brothers, Brycen Roberts, Celina, and Waylon Fuson, Celina; three sisters, Madison Soper, Decatur, IN, Piper Fuson, St. Marys, and Macy Fuson St. Marys; Grandparents, Becky Fuson, Celina, Sherri (Jack) Grant, St. Marys, and Dan (Tabby) Roberts, Port Orange, FL; great grandparents, Chalmer "Whitey" (Pat) Kuhn, FL, Lonnie (Gloria) Fuson, KY, Ed (Hazel) Grant, St. Marys; and numerous, aunts, uncles, and cousins.
Preceded in death by a grandfather, John Fuson; and great grandparents, Bud (Sherry) Goins, and John (Mary Ann) Roberts.
Trinity attended St. Paul's United Methodist Church, Celina, Ohio. She lived her life like any other two year old, she was always on the go, loved driving daddy's truck, loved dancing to music, being beautiful and loved playing with her siblings. During her two short years on Earth she touched many lives and was loved deeply by her family and friends.
Services are pending at Cisco Funeral Home, Celina, Ohio.
